Frequently Asked Questions about Fort Smith

How much are Studio apartments in Fort Smith?

There are currently 24 Studio Apartments in Fort Smith with rent ranges from $1,750 to $1,750 with an average price of $1,750.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fort Smith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fort Smith ranges from $413 to $7,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,444.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fort Smith c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fort Smith range from $559 to $3,450.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,014.

How expensive are Fort Smith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 50 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fort Smith on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$699 to $2,605 - averaging $1,475 for the location.
